Ingerana reticulata is a species of frog in the family Dicroglossidae.
As presently known, it is endemic to Mêdog County in southeastern Tibet, China,[1][2][3] but its range might extend to northeast India, given the proximity of the border.

[4] Ingerana reticulata has been found among rocks next to small rivers and brooks within tropical moist forest.
Development might be direct[1] (i.e, there is no free-living larval stage[6]), as in its relatives.
